If you're talking about the initial price you pay a breeder I honestly don't think there is a most expensive breed, Bulldogs can run pretty high on average but so do many, many other breeds. The price depends on what each individual breeder wants to sell the puppies for. The average price for my 3 favourite breeds (Tollers, Groenendaels & Rotties) is between $1000 & $2500, there are some under and over those prices of course but that's the average. I've also seen breeders who want $4000+ and personally, I think that's absolutely insane.....
If you're talking about vet bills, I'd have to say generally speaking, Great Danes and other similar giant breeds would be the most expensive due to their short life span and health issues that come with these breeds. Small dogs can be really expensive as well because some owners don't brush their teeth often enough and small dogs are known for dental issues which can cost a lot to fix if you let their teeth get to s certain point, the same goes far all sizes of dogs but smaller ones I've found, seem to have the most problems.
Obviously, all of what I've said is just my opinion......
It is a very hard thing to judge but I'd say all around, Neapolitan Mastiffs.
They are expensive to buy because they are hard to breed. (mom and easily squash pups) Around $1500-$3000+
They are expensive to feed because they are massive.
Their vet bills usually run high.
